Can I live in Krakow on $1,500/month?
Living in Krakow on $1,500/mo is rated "Comfortable". Budget allocates ~$682 to rent, $283 to groceries, $193 to dining.
Can I live in São Paulo on $1,500/month?
In São Paulo, $1,500/mo is rated "Comfortable". Allocations: $649 rent, $390 groceries, $183 dining.
Is Krakow or São Paulo cheaper?
São Paulo is generally cheaper. COL+Rent: Krakow 27.4 vs São Paulo 23.4 (NYC=100).
What is $1,500/mo in Krakow worth in São Paulo?
$1,500/mo of purchasing power in Krakow equals ~$1,281/mo in São Paulo using COL adjustment.
